abracadabraPDF › Forums › PDF – Général › Validation de valeur d’un champ de saisie › Répondre à : Validation de valeur d’un champ de saisie
26 mai 2021 à 07:34
#69269
Merlin
Maître des clés
Je te propose ce script (non testé), mais il ne vérifie pas le point n°3 (entier ou finissant par ,5). Je saurais vérifier si c’est un entier mais pour le ,5 je sèche…
Code:
var cMessage = “La valeur saisie n’est pas conforme, merci de recommencer.”;
var nNotauto = Number(this.getField(“note20”).value);
var nNotauto = Number(this.getField(“note20”).value);
if (event.value.toString().length == 0) {
event.rc = true;
}
else {
if (event.value 20) {
app.alert(cMessage);
}
event.rc = false;
else {
event.rc = true;
}
}
Concernant le point n°4, c’est simple : il faut créer un champ masqué qui calcule le “maximum” des deux champs “note20” et “note20p” et utiliser ce champ comme base de calcul pour le champ “note60”. Capture ci-joint.